1.The relationship between sperm DNA integrity, semen parameters, seminal plasma neutral α-glucosidase activity and IVF/ICSI outcomes
Zhenhua CHANG ; Baohua MIN ; Xiaoyan REN ; Shuwei YAN ; Zhenhua LU ; Sanhua WEI
Journal of Chinese Physician 2025;27(7):1009-1013
Objective:To explore the relationship between sperm DNA integrity, semen parameters, seminal plasma neutral α-glucosidase activity and in vitro fertilization/intracytoplasmic sperm injection (IVF/ICSI) outcomes. Methods:The clinical data of 300 male infertile patients who underwent routine semen analysis in the Second Affiliated Hospital of Air Force Medical University from October 2023 to April 2024 and whose spouses received IVF/ICSI treatment were retrospectively analyzed. The results of sperm DNA integrity [sperm DNA fragmentation index (DFI)], semen parameters (sperm percentage, sperm density, sperm motility, normal morphology sperm rate) and seminal plasma neutral α-glucosidase activity at admission were recorded. According to their spouses′ IVF/ICSI outcomes, the 300 patients were divided into the successful pregnancy group (those with successful intrauterine pregnancy detected by ultrasound 30 days after transplantation) and the unsuccessful pregnancy group (those without successful intrauterine pregnancy detected by ultrasound 30 days after transplantation). The differences in sperm DNA integrity, semen parameters and seminal plasma neutral α-glucosidase activity at admission between the two groups were compared. The receiver operating characteristic (ROC) curve was used to analyze the predictive efficacy of sperm DNA integrity, semen parameters and seminal plasma neutral α-glucosidase activity in male infertile patients at admission for their spouses′ IVF/ICSI outcomes.Results:According to the IVF/ICSI outcomes of the spouses of male infertile patients, 169 cases (56.3%) had successful intrauterine pregnancy detected by ultrasound 30 days after transplantation; 131 cases (43.7%) had unsuccessful intrauterine pregnancy. At admission, there was no statistically significant difference in clinical data between the two groups (all P>0.05). The DFI and sperm density in the successful pregnancy group were lower than those in the unsuccessful pregnancy group, while the sperm percentage, sperm motility, normal morphology sperm rate and seminal plasma neutral α-glucosidase activity were higher than those in the unsuccessful pregnancy group (all P<0.05). The area under the ROC curve (AUC) values of single indicators including DFI, sperm percentage, sperm density, sperm motility, normal morphology sperm rate, and seminal plasma neutral α-glucosidase level in predicting the IVF/ICSI outcomes of spouses of male infertile patients were 0.719, 0.718, 0.812, 0.779, 0.769, and 0.736, respectively; the sensitivities were 70.42%, 77.46%, 69.01%, 70.42%, 69.01%, and 77.46%, respectively; the specificities were 66.38%, 55.02%, 81.22%, 73.80%, 77.29%, and 62.88%, respectively; the Youden indexes were 0.368, 0.325, 0.502, 0.442, 0.463, and 0.404, respectively; all differences were statistically significant (all P<0.05). Conclusions:Sperm DNA integrity, semen parameters and seminal plasma neutral α-glucosidase activity can assist in predicting IVF/ICSI outcomes, providing an important reference for the treatment outcomes of male infertile patients.
2.Analysis of Vaginal Microflora Examination Results in 19322 Initial Visit Infertil-ity Women
Zhenhua CHANG ; Shuwei YAN ; Xiaoyan REN ; Baohua MIN ; Xiaojuan XIE ; Zhenhua LU ; Sanhua WEI
Journal of Practical Obstetrics and Gynecology 2025;41(7):563-567
Objective:To investigate the characteristic distribution of vaginal microbiota in infertile women.Methods:We collected the results of vaginal microbiological examinations from 19322 initial visit infertile women who visited the Reproductive Medicine Center of the Department of Obstetrics and Gynecology,the Second Affili-ated Hospital of Air Force Medical University from March 1,2023 to July 31,2024.The vaginal microbiota infection status of patients was compared in different age groups(<25 years old,25-<30 years old,30-<35 years old,35-<40 years old,≥40 years old)and different seasons(spring,summer,autumn,winter).Results:①Among 19322 women,6027 cases(31.19%)showed abnormal vaginal microecology.Pathogenic microorganisms were detected in 3093 cases,including 2882 cases of single vaginitis,211 cases of mixed vaginitis,3764 cases with vagi-nal cleanliness grade Ⅲ-Ⅳ,and 3965 cases with abnormal lactobacilli.Among patients with single vaginitis,1349 cases(46.81%)were diagnosed with vulvovaginal candidiasis(VVC),which was the highest proportion.Aerobic vaginitis(AV)followed with 752 cases(26.09%),and bacterial vaginosis(BV)had 671 cases(23.28%),trichomonal vaginitis(TV)with 110 cases(3.82%).Among patients with mixed vaginitis,AV+BV was the most common with 96 cases(45.49%).②The detection rates of cleanliness grade Ⅲ-Ⅳ,abnormal lactobacilli,abnor-mal microorganisms(unclear pathogen),single vaginitis(BV,VVC and TV),and mixed vaginitis showed statisti-cally significant differences across different seasons(P<0.05).Specifically,the detection rates of cleanliness grade Ⅲ-Ⅳ and abnormal microorganisms(unclear pathogens)were significantly higher in autumn than in other seasons(P<0.05),while the detection rate of abnormal lactobacilli was higher in spring than in other seasons(P<0.05).③The detection rates of abnormal lactobacilli,abnormal microorganisms(unclear pathogen),single vaginitis(BV,VVC and AV),and mixed vaginitis showed significant differences among different age groups(P<0.05).Specifically,the detection rate of abnormal microorganisms(unclear pathogen)was higher in the age group<25 years than in other age groups(P<0.05),while the detection rate of BV among single vaginitis cases was higher in the age group≥40 years than in other age groups(P<0.05).Conclusions:The vaginal microecol-ogy of infertile women varies in terms of infection rates across different age groups and seasons.Patients with simple vaginitis have the highest rate of VVC,while those with mixed vaginitis have the highest proportion of AV+BV infection.
3.The research on the association between genetic alterations of DLBCLs and 18F-FDG PET/CT SUVmax and their clinical significance
Tian TIAN ; Chen CHEN ; Ran WEI ; Longlong BAO ; Bingxin GU ; Qunling ZHANG ; Junning CAO ; Baohua YU ; Xiaoqiu LI ; Xiaoyan ZHOU
China Oncology 2025;35(6):531-542
Background and purpose:Next generation sequencing-identified genetic alterations of diffuse large B cell lymphoma(DLBCL)and baseline SUVmax detected by 18F-FDG PET/CT were correlated with patients'prognosis.However,their relationship and the associations with R-CHOP response of DLBCL are still unclear.This study aimed to analyze the association bewteen genetic alterations and 18F-FDG PET/CT SUVmax and their correlations with clinicopathological characteristics and R-CHOP response of DLBCL.Methods:A total of 225 cases of primary DLBCL detected by next generation sequencing using 481 lymphoma gene panel and examined by 18F-FDG PET/CT before treatment between 2022 and 2023 were collected.This study was approved by the Ethics Committee of Fudan University Shanghai Cancer Center(Ethical No.:050432-4-2307E)and acquired the informed consent of the patients.The translocations of BCL2,BCL6 and MYC were identified by fluorescence in situ hybridization.The clinicopathological characteristics and the PET/CT scan after R-CHOP chemotherapy were collected.Results:Finally,191 patients were enrolled in this study.The frequency of MYD88 mutation,TP53 mutation,copy number variations of CDKN2A/2B,CD79B mutation in the 191 DLBCL patients were 24.6%,27.2%,32.5%and 16.8%,respectively.The range of baseline SUVmax was 5.10-63.10(24.44±10.70,median 22.80).The baseline SUVmax of MYD88L265P DLBCL was significantly higher than that of MYD88 wild type(P=0.039).There were no significant associations of SUVmax with other gene alterations including TP53 mutation,CDKN2A/B loss,CD79B mutation,KMT2D mutation,TNFAIP3 mutation,B2M mutation,EZH2 mutation,BTG1/2 mutation,CREBBP mutation,gene translocations of MYC,BCL2 and BCL6.The higher SUVmax before treatment was correlated with higher serum lactate dehydrogenase(LDH)level(P=0.012)and non-germinal center B-cell-like(non-GCB)DLBCL(P=0.040).However,there was no significant association of SUVmax with R-CHOP response(P=0.714).TP53 mutation was significantly associated with the poor response of R-CHOP(P=0.001)and was an independent predictor of non-complete metabolic response(non-CMR).TP53 mutation combined with Ann Arbor stage,International Prognostic Index(IPI)score and serum LDH level could better predict R-CHOP response than each factor alone.Conclusion:MYD88L265P DLBCL had higher baseline 18F-FDG PET/CT SUVmax.The baseline SUVmax was not associated with R-CHOP response.However,TP53 mutation was significantly correlated with poor response of R-CHOP in DLBCL patients.TP53 mutation combined with clinicopathological characteristics could better predict R-CHOP response.The associations of gene alterations and SUVmax with prognosis of DLBCL patients needed to be explored in the future.
4.Application of an improved"outside-in"technique in hip arthroscopic surgery
Jing YANG ; Qiang WANG ; Baojin SU ; Baohua HE ; Hang SHI ; Yuchen SHANG ; Wei DONG ; Mengru LI ; Yuhao ZHENG ; Jin ZHANG
Chinese Journal of Sports Medicine 2025;44(3):171-176
Objective To explore the clinical effect of applying an improved"outside-in"technique in hip arthroscopic surgery.Methods Totally 136 patients undergoing hip arthroscopic surgery between June 2021 and July 2023 were selected and studied retrospectively.According to their different surgi-cal approach,they were divided into a modified approach group(n=75,including 30 males and 45 fe-males,with an average age of 36±14)and a classic approach group(n=61,including 33 males and 28 females,with an average age of 31±11).Before as well as 4 weeks,3 months and 6 months after the surgery,both groups were evaluated using the visual analog scale(VAS)and Harris hip score,and observed their surgical complications.Moreover,the surgical outcomes and time of sur-gical approach establishment were compared between the two groups.Results There was no significant difference between the two groups in general information,preoperative VAS and Harris scores.More-over,no significant difference was found between the two groups in the Harris score after surgery.Compared with the classic approach group,the improved group had significantly less surgical time(49.0±16.9 min vs.66.0±13.3 min,P<0.05),without using the C-arm fluoroscopy during surgery.Moreover,in the modified approach group,the time for establishing the mid-anteriorapproach was sig-nificantly shortened(10.4±5.9 min vs.25.9±15.1 min,P<0.05),along with the traction time during surgery(66.0±13.3 min vs.49.0±16.9 min,P<0.05).Conclusion The modified"outside-in"hip ar-throscopy technique is a safe and effective surgical method,easier to operate,with shorter surgical time.

9.Comparison of small extracellular vesicles derived from stem cells and tissue on de novo adipose regeneration
Baohua YANG ; Xiaojie ZHOU ; Wei JING ; Weidong TIAN ; Mei YU
Chinese Journal of Tissue Engineering Research 2024;28(25):3981-3987
BACKGROUND:De novo adipose regeneration induced by small extracellular vesicles has become a promising method for repairing soft tissue defects.However,due to different animal models and small extracellular vesicle application dosages,it is difficult to quantitatively compare the therapeutic effect of small extracellular vesicles from various sources on adipose regeneration. OBJECTIVE:To compare the regenerative effects of small extracellular vesicles derived from stem cells and small extracellular vesicles from tissue. METHODS:Small extracellular vesicles derived from adipose-derived stem cells and from adipose tissue were isolated by ultracentrifugation.The particle number,particle size,morphology,and protein expression of small extracellular vesicles were identified by nanoparticle tracking analysis,transmission electron microscopy and western blot assay.A quantitative and evaluative subcutaneous model for adipose regeneration in C57 mice was established using a customized silicone tube.The regenerative effects of induced de novo adipose were compared by cell counting and hematoxylin-eosin staining. RESULTS AND CONCLUSION:(1)Small extracellular vesicles derived from adipose-derived stem cells and from adipose tissue were isolated by ultracentrifugation.Both small extracellular vesicles were round-shape in transmission electron microscopy with particle size between 50-200 nm,and abundant with the small extracellular vesicles marker protein CD81,CD63 and TSG101.(2)An equal number of small extracellular vesicles were mixed with matrigel in customized silicone tubes,implanted subcutaneously in the back of mice to establish a cell-free and quantifiable adipose regeneration model.(3)On days 3 and 7 after implantation,the results of cell counting and hematoxylin-eosin staining showed that both small extracellular vesicle groups recruited more host cells than the blank group,and the small extracellular vesicles derived from adipose tissue group were superior to the small extracellular vesicles derived from adipose-derived stem cell group.(4)4 weeks after implantation,hematoxylin-eosin staining of the contents in silicone tubes showed that small extracellular vesicles induced de novo adipose regeneration in vivo,and the small extracellular vesicles derived from adipose tissue group were superior to the small extracellular vesicles derived from adipose-derived stem cell group.The above results indicated that small extracellular vesicles derived from tissues have a superior effect on inducing de novo adipose regeneration compared to small extracellular vesicles derived from stem cells.
10.Construction and function validation of inducible immortalized gene integration vectors
Wei YUE ; Yue YANG ; Baohua QIAN ; Yanxin LI ; Haihui GU
Chinese Journal of Blood Transfusion 2024;37(12):1341-1349
[Abstract] [Objective] To construct inducible immortalization gene vectors for transfection into primary cells, enabling the establishment of a conditionally immortalized cell line that support their sustained cultivation and proliferation in vitro. [Methods] Using gene homologous recombination technology, the coding sequences (CDS) of immortalization genes-including human telomerase reverse transcriptase (hTERT), simian virus 40 large T antigen (SV40LT), acute myeloid leukemia fusion genes NUP98-KDM5A (N/K) and CBFA2T3-GLIS2 (C/G), as well as the proto-oncogene KRAS were precisely inserted into the tetracycline (Tet)-inducible eukaryotic expression lentiviral vector pLV2-TRE3GS-EGFP-MCS-3×FLAG-hPGK-Tet-On-SV40-Neo and the transposon PB-TRE3G-3×FLAG-T2A-Puro-SV40-PA. Lentiviral packaging, cell transfection, mRNA expression analysis, Western blotting for protein detection, green fluorescent protein (GFP) visualization, and cell proliferation assays were conducted to evaluate transfection efficiency and assess the regulatory effects of Tet on gene expression in 293T and MEF cells. [Results] The Tet-inducible lentiviral vectors pLV2-Tet-SV40LT, pLV2-Tet-N/K, and pLV2-Tet-C/G, along with the transposon vectors PB-Tet-hTERT, PB-Tet-SV40LT, PB-Tet-N/K, PB-Tet-C/G, and PB-Tet-KRAS, were successfully constructed. In 293T cells, the expression levels of all target genes were upregulated after transfection. In MEF cells, the immortalizing functions of SV40LT and N/K were validated. By modulating Tet addition, cell proliferation levels were effectively regulated, leading to the successful establishment of conditionally immortalized pLV2-SV40LT-MEF and pLV2-N/K-MEF cell lines. [Conclusion] The construction of Tet-inducible immortalizing gene vectors provides a technical foundation for establishing conditionally immortalized primary cell lines, thereby facilitating research on the large-scale in vitro production and expansion of blood cells, such as erythrocytes and platelets.
